While many refer to RMIS as a system, that choice is not complete, and may be misleading. Recognizing it as an interconnected service is more complete. A system implies ‘automatic’ whereas a service requires conscious user involvement. We all have direct experience with systems. We use them for heating, plumbing, and electrical functions every day. Pitfalls of Averages in Risk Management and Claims Applications We all know the big three: counts, total incurred and average. The first two come directly from your claim data and the average is simply computed by dividing the total incurred by the claim count.
